"Session 1- English Communication skills"

"Session 2- Importance of Pharmacovigilance and Drug Regulatory Affairs"

On 6th October 2023 Induction Programme 2023-24, continued at GN group of Institutes, GNIT College of Pharmacy. Day 4 of the Induction Programme was marked by two insightful sessions delivered by two eminent speakers. The sessions aimed to enrich the knowledge and skills of the participants.

The event began with a session on Communication Skills by Ms. Bachendri Pathak, a senior trainer at Inlingua, took the stage to discuss the significance of communication skills in the professional world. Her session emphasized how effective communication can enhance one's personal and professional life. Ms. Pathak stressed the importance of clear and concise communication in conveying ideas and information effectively. She highlighted the role of non-verbal cues, such as body language and gestures, in conveying messages accurately. Participants were encouraged to practice active listening, a crucial skill in effective communication. Ms. Pathak shared techniques to boost confidence in communication, including public speaking tips. The session addressed common communication barriers and how to overcome them.

In the next part of event another session on Importance of Pharmacovigilance and Drug Regulatory Affairs by Mr. Kunwar Srivastava.

The second session was led by Mr. Kunwar Srivastava, an HR professional at the ACPL group of companies, who delved into the world of Pharmacovigilance and drug regulatory affairs in the field of Pharmacy. Mr. Srivastava provided an overview of what Pharmacovigilance is and why it's crucial in the pharmaceutical industry. He discussed the role of regulatory affairs in ensuring compliance with laws and regulations governing the pharmaceutical sector. Participants learned about the importance of monitoring and reporting adverse drug reactions to ensure public safety. Mr. Srivastava highlighted the career opportunities and growth prospects in the field of Pharmacovigilance and regulatory affairs.

Overall, both sessions were highly informative and provided valuable insights to the participants. The induction programme continues to equip them with the knowledge and skills necessary for their roles in the pharmaceutical industry.

Seminar on career guidance, GPAT exam preparation and development of soft skills :

GNIT College of Pharmacy, GN Group of Institutions, hosted a seminar on career guidance, GPAT exam preparation, and soft skill development on its campus to instil the correct value system and proper understanding of the professional course, its outcome, foreseeable challenges, and opportunities available. The occasion was marked by the presence of the Director, HOD, faculty members, invited visitors, and dignitaries.

Dr. Anju Guaniya highlighted the various factors of success and discipline in her address to the scholar and educated them on the required behaviour of pharmacy students.

Mr. Utsav Verma, Assistant Professor, GPAT Discussion Center, was our distinguished speaker and technical session honoree. He focused on the profession of pharmacy. A pharmacist is vital in assisting individuals in maintaining their health.

As a pharmacist, we must communicate with people under duress. Mr. Verma outlined the benefits of passing the GPAT, like being eligible for admission to top-tier universities for M.Pharm studies, entrance exam, monthly stipend, and being able to participate in any research project as a JRF Project Fellow. You also become eligible for PhD programmes, as many prestigious institutes have made GPAT/NET eligibility criteria. There was lively and exciting query placed by students curious about future prospects as a pharmacist.

The session was concluded with a vote of thanks by HOD Mr. Anil Sahdev.
